Simple, sturdy ... but for smaller "backsides" than mine

Hi,

I bought this throne for our rehearsal space, because I am too lazy to bring my other K&M throne. For half the price of my "regular" throne I got a very sturdy and simple to use drum throne with enough height difference for tall and small users.

The only - and purely personal - drawback for me comes from the fact that my "backside" is too big for the seat, so it would be a problem for proper long gigs of 3 x 1 hour sets or so, Having said that: I am 6 foot 3 (about 1,90 m) and weigh 150 kg ... so the throne is definitely sturdy, and by "b*tt" is definitely too big.

Anyone else should definitely consider buying this model here - highly recommended.

Technical Data

  • Manufactured by K&M
  • Released in 1999
  • Average price : $110
  • Tripod base with double braces and large diameter
  • Collapsible
  • Incrementally adjustable height
  • With surface-preserving clamp
  • The large clamp screw and an additional locking bolt enable simple and secure use
  • Seat is detachable and the base collapsible
  • Minimum seat height of 500 mm
  • Large, comfortable seat Ø 325 mm with synthetic leather cover
  • Weight : 6.18kg
  • Height: 500 / 765 mm
